Sarah Gallagher is 18 years old, has been dancing for 16 years and competed for 6 years. She was captain of the St. Thomas More Sparkler Dance team and is a 3x Jazz and 2x Pom national champion. She performed in the Reconstruct show in Los Angeles in November 2022. Currently, she is a Universal Dance Association Staff Instructor and choreographs and teaches for many studios in Louisiana.

How do you incorporate movement into your everyday life?
I do something related to dancing every single day, whether that be choreography, teaching, assisting, or improv. I love going to the gym and working out with friends or family. Powerlifting has also been a really fun hobby that I enjoy.
Who is your favorite mover of all time, and why?
My favorite mover would have to be my sister Hannah. She trained me and pushed me to be the best dancer I could be ever since I was little. She is one of the greatest choreographers out there, and her creativity and passion inspires me every day.
What legacy do you hope to leave behind for the next generation of movers?
I hope to inspire the next generation and keep the passion for dance and movement alive. The people who left their passionate legacy have inspired me to still dance today, and I would love to be that kind of role model for others. Prioritizing the enjoyment of movement and creativity is something I always want pass on.
What are some staple clothing pieces in your closet that assist you on your movement journey?
Any time I dance, I always pick my biker shorts and my sports bra tops. They are the most comfortable and allow me to move the most. I also love wearing sweatpants and a hoodie when going to the gym.
